中山市软件有限公司

软件开发 ·
首页 / 资讯 / 上海商城系统开发:技术要求清单解析

上海商城系统开发:技术要求清单解析

上海商城系统开发:技术要求清单解析
软件开发 上海商城系统开发技术要求清单 发布:2026-06-11

标题:上海商城系统开发:技术要求清单解析

一、商城系统概述

随着电子商务的快速发展,商城系统已成为企业拓展线上业务的重要工具。上海商城系统作为一种集商品展示、交易、支付、物流等功能于一体的平台,对于企业来说,选择合适的技术方案至关重要。

二、技术要求清单

1. 前端技术 - HTML5/CSS3:保证页面布局的响应式和兼容性。 - JavaScript:实现页面交互和动态效果。 - Vue.js/React.js:提高开发效率和组件化程度。

2. 后端技术 - Java/Python/Node.js:根据项目需求选择合适的服务器端语言。 - Spring Boot/Django/Express:简化开发流程,提高开发效率。 - MySQL/Oracle:选择稳定可靠的数据库系统。

3. 架构设计 - 微服务架构:提高系统可扩展性和可维护性。 - 领域驱动设计(DDD):确保系统逻辑清晰,易于维护。 - 分布式事务:保证数据的一致性。

4. DevOps - Git:版本控制,方便代码管理和协作。 - Docker:容器化部署,提高部署效率。 - Jenkins:自动化构建和部署。

5. 安全性 - SSL证书:保证数据传输的安全性。 - 防火墙:防止恶意攻击。 - 数据加密:保护用户隐私。

6. 性能优化 - 缓存:提高系统响应速度。 - 索引优化:提高数据库查询效率。 - 负载均衡:提高系统并发处理能力。

三、技术选型理由

1. 技术成熟度 - 选择业界成熟的技术,降低项目风险。 - 提高开发效率和稳定性。

2. 技术生态 - 选择有丰富生态支持的技术,方便后续扩展和维护。 - 降低开发成本。

3. 团队经验 - 选择团队熟悉的技术,提高项目成功率。

四、总结

上海商城系统开发技术要求清单涵盖了前端、后端、架构设计、DevOps、安全性和性能优化等多个方面。企业在选择技术方案时,应综合考虑技术成熟度、生态、团队经验等因素,以确保项目顺利进行。

本文由 中山市软件有限公司 整理发布。

更多软件开发文章

OA系统:功能清单揭秘与价格解析OA系统开发费用构成解析:揭秘成本背后的秘密传统软件采购的隐性成本,正在倒逼企业重新审视定制开发的价值软件验收测试:关键步骤与注意事项解析定制开发外包:中小企业技术升级的双刃剑ERP系统定制开发:成本构成与考量因素医疗软件定制开发:价格背后的考量因素制造业ERP系统开发费用:揭秘成本构成与优化策略Web系统开发项目预算:如何科学制定与控制定制软件售后维护合同:维护软件生命力的关键协议开发一个app需要多少天揭秘APP定制开发:品牌排名背后的真相
友情链接: 推荐链接上海生物科技有限公司广州药业连锁有限公司合作伙伴文化传媒本地服务杭州影视策划有限公司哈尔滨市俄罗斯油画美术馆农业机械